TICKETS are running out for this year’s Boltfest, which returns to Queens Park in May.
With 15,000 people set to attend this year’s music event, revellers are being advised by organisers to book early and avoid disappointment at the gates as 70 per cent of tickets have already been snapped up.
The two-day music tribute festival, on May 28 and 29, is set to host some of Europe’s biggest tribute acts to Queen, Coldplay, Bowie, Metallica, Kings Of Leon plus many more.
Tickets are free aside the booking fee of £2.90. They are available online from boltfest.com or from X Records in Bridge Street, Bolton town centre, whilst stocks last.
